Behavior of the extramural uterine arteries in crossbred dogs (Canis familiaris - Linnaeus, 1758)

The present study involved thirty femeale adult dogs coming from the kennel of the Veterinary Hospital of the Federal University of Uberlândia, Minas Gerais, Brazil. The thoracic cavity of the animal was opened and the aorta astery (thoracic part) was locared and canulated. A 450 Neoprene latex solution was used to injet the aorta astery in caudal direction. The specimens were then fixed in a 10 % formol aqueous solution. The results showed that the ovaric, uterine and vaginal arteries supply the uterus as follows : (1) the ovaric artery, in all the cases, arose from the aorta artery, either cranially to the caudal mesenteric artery (98,33%) or at same level of this artery (1,67%). In 83,33% of the cases, it gave off a branch to the uterine corns, which was distributed on the dorsal (8,00%), on the ventral (12,00%) and ond the both (80,00%) surfaces. In addition, two uterine branches distributed on the ventral (66,67%) and the dorsal (33,33%) surfaces were found in 10,00% of the cases; (2) the uterine artery, in all the cases, arose from the vaginal artery. In all the specimens the artery uterine supplied the uterine corns, with the ventral surfaces receiving greater mean number of branches than the dorsal surface. Concerning the uterine body the mean number of branches from the uterine artery showed to be greater on the dorsal surface. In 70, 00% of the cases, the uterine cervix received branches from directly from the uterine artery, with greater number of these arterial vessels being found on the ventral surface.

Cultivo individual de blastocistos bovinos produzidos in vitro

In vitro produced bovine embryos were individually cultured from D7 to D9 to observe their development. Forty-nine blastocysts (early blastocyst, blastocyst and expanded blastocyst) were individually cultured, from D7 to D9 (D0= fertilization), in 50ml SOF medium plus 5% OCS. Between D7 and D8, blastocysts were cultured in straws (SC) or in plates (PC) and from D8 up to D9, they were cultured on plates. The ratio of early blastocyst, blastocyst, and expanded blastocyst advancing at least one stage of development were, respectively, 71%, 37%, 44% in PC and 100%, 66%, 36% in SC (P>;0.05). Overall development rates on D8 were not significantly different (P>;0.05) for PC (50%) and SC (60%). At D9, both culture systems produced similar (P>;0.05) hatching rates (29% and 24% for PC and SC, respectively). After fluorescent nuclei staining, the average number of cells counted in the hatched (182.7 vs. 202.8) and expanding (94.5 vs. 88.0) blastocysts were similar (P>;0.05) for PC and SC, respectively. In vitro produced bovine blastocysts can be individually cultured from D7 to D9, and the culture system employed (dishes or straws) has no effect on hatching rates and cell number of developed blastocysts.

Avaliação clínica, colpo-citológica e endocrinológica de fêmeas de Cerdocyon thous do zoológico do Rio de Janeiro

Serial clinical, colpo-cytological and endocrinological examinations of two five-year-old females of the crab-eating dog (Cerdocyon thous), from the RIOZOO Foundation in the State of Rio de Janeiro - Brazil, were carried out over a 10-month period. Clinically healthy animals were kept in sand substratum enclosures, located 500m apart from each other. They were each housed with two males. The colpo-cytological technique employed for Cerdocyon thous used methods similar to those developed for domestic bitches. Unlike domestic dogs, blood cells were absent in all phases of the estrus cycle, including the pro-estrus phase. Differentiation of each type of vaginal cells during the estrus cycle phases in this species follows the same patterns shown by domestic bitches. The estradiol and progesterone levels were similar to those occurring in domestic bitches. The progesterone levels reach their maximum (46 ng/ml) around the 10th day of pregnancy. The estradiol analysis demonstrated that, although levels of this hormone could be high at various times throughout the year, mating actually occurs in late winter and in spring. It was impossible to evaluate whether males and females kept in close proximity throughout the entire year would stimulate the production of estradiol, resulting in what would be considered a captivity artifice.

Mechanical properties of three patterns of suture in the repair of tendon of the muscle deep digital flexor equine

Four mechanical properties: Maximum Limit (ML), Elasticity Limit (EL), Rigidity (RG) and Resilience (RS), of three suture patterns, they were appraised, for mechanical tests of traction. Thirty tendons of the muscles deep digital flexores, of corpses of equine, were separate in three groups of equal number and approximate with the sutures of modified Kessler with suture in the epitendon (MK), modified Becker (MB) and double-locking loop (DL). The resistance to the space formation and the tension loss was also appraised. The results showed that for the load, in ML, only the suture pattern MK was shown significantly different (P<0,05); while, in PL, the three suture patterns behaved equally. As for the deformation, in ML and in EL, the three suture patterns presented significant differences amongst themselves (P<0,05). In RG, only MK behaved different (P<0,05). And, in RS, the three suture patterns presented significant differences amongst themselves (P<0,05). As for the failure, the pattern MK failed for distention and loss of the function of the suture, while the patterns suture MB and DL failed for rupture of the thread. The suture pattern MK was shown superior to the other ones two, whose mechanical properties were equivalent

Application of direct immunofluorescence technic for the diagnosis of canine visceral leishmaniasis in lymph nodes aspirate

Recently, canine visceral leishmaniasis (CVL) was detected in the northwest of São Paulo State - Brazil. The Veterinary Hospital - UNESP - Araçatuba, in 2.000, carried out 60 cytopathological test of suspected cases of leishmaniasis using the fine-needle aspiration (FNA). The smears of the FNA popliteal lymph nodes were stained by the Romanowsky stain (Diff-Quik®) and observed using a light microscope. The positive cases showed typical amastigotes forms of Leishmania either free or in macrophage vacuoles. Cytopathological signs of reactivity of the lymph-hystiocitary system with the absence of parasites were also detected. In order to improve the diagnosis of CVL, looking for parasites and antigenic material detection in smears, we standardized the direct immunofluorescence assay (IFD) using mouse anti-Leishmania policlonal antibodies. We compared the IFD assay with the direct search of parasites in smears stained by Romanowsky stain. From the 60 dogs with clinical signs of the disease, the direct exam was positive in 50% (n=30), uncertain in 36,7% (n=22) and negative with lymph node reativity in 13,3% (n=8). When the lymph node smears were submitted to IFD assay we observed positive reaction in 93,3% (n=56) and negative reaction in 6,7% (n=4). Our results showed that IFD assay presented a high sensibility compared to parasite direct search by Romanowsky stain. The IFD assay could be useful method to confirm the uncertain cases of the disease, where amastigotes forms were not clearly identified.

Serum IgG level in calves experimentally infected with Haemonchus placei

Two experiments were conducted to determine the serum antibody (IgG) dynamic in calves infected with Haemonchus placei. At Experiment 1, the IgG level during the first and second experimental infection were measured and at Experiment 2, the influence of dietary protein and immunization on IgG levels. The calves were immunized using successive H. placei infection truncated by the use of anthelmintic and challenged with 100,000 L3. The infected calves developed a high level of protection, with a significant reduction on fecal egg counts (EPG) at the second infection. However, at the same period, the IgG values continue to presented high levels, independent of the EPG decrease. It was also observed that calves submitted to an adequate protein diet presented a higher IgG level, suggesting an influence on immune response to the infection when compared to the low protein diet calves.

Unexpected chromosomal alterations in Tayassu tajacu (Artiodactyla: Tayassuidae) in captivity

Wild animals have been used as bioindicators in situations in which the environment was exposed to chemical agents. In general, chemical agents may induce chromosomal aberrations, such as breaks and gaps. The peccary, Tayassu tajacu is a pig relative that exhibits a very stable karyotype with the only described alterations being of the form of the X chromosome. Chromosomal gaps and breaks were observed at high frequencies during cytogenetics analyses. These alterations were observed in the chromosomes autossomics. Reviews of the literature and of the data described herein suggests that an vermifuge, the ivermectin base, was the most likely cause of these chromosomal alterations.

Comparative study of the irrigation of the mammary papilla in mongrel dogs (Canis familiaris, Linnaeus, 1758)

We analyzed the distribution and the arterial vascular arrangement of the mammary papilla (MP) in 45 adult mongrel dogs: 15 multiparous females, 15 nulliparous and 15 males. Our ai consists of comparing the irrigation of mammary papillas in these groups for applications in morphology, reproduction, clinic, surgery (anatomicosurgical segmentation) and correlated areas. The specimens were collected in the Center of Zoonosis of Goiânia, they were injected with latex substance, fixed, and then their mammary complexes were analyzed by dissection and also by radiograph. The irrigation of the mammary papilla was classified in direct terminal (DT), direct continuous (DC) and indirect (I). The irrigation of the terminal direct type predominated in the pairs of antimerous 1 and 3 in the three studied groups, showing higher frequency, and not significant in the pair of mamma 2 in nulíparas, and equivalence in comparison to the type of indirect irrigation in multíparas and males in this exactly pair of mama. The type of indirect irrigation prevailed in the pair of mamma 4 and, in the pair of mamma 5, this model of irrigation was described in 100% of the analyzed cases.

Effect of dietary supplementation of unsaturated fatty acids and vitamin E upon yolk lipid composition and alpha- tocopherol incorportation into the egg yolk

To investigate the effect of dietary sources of polyunsaturated fatty acids - canola oil (6%), flaxseed (20%) or the combination of both (3% canola oil and 10% flaxseed), and vitamin E supplementation (0,100 e 200 IU/kg of diet) upon the fatty acids and alpha-tocopherol deposition into the eggs, 288 Babcock laying hens were used for a 11 week experimental period. Hens fed 20% flaxseed diet showed a significant reduction of egg weight, feed efficiency, egg production, eggshell thickness and eggshell weight. The inclusion of flaxseed in the diet increased the polyunsaturated fatty acids, depressed monounsaturated fatty acids incorporated into the egg yolk, and increased the ratio P/S (polyunsaturated:saturated fatty acids). Yolk alpha-tocopherol concentration was proportional to its content in the diet (R²=0.9613). Birds fed diets with 6% of canola oil had greater alpha-tocopherol deposition into the eggs.

Comparison of ultrasonography and positive contrast cystography for detection of urinary bladder disorders in dogs

Imaging techniques are often of great value in detecting lower urinary tract abnormalities in small animals, which frequently affect the urinary bladder. Survey and contrast radiography and ultrasonography allow evaluation of bladder shape, position and internal anatomy. The objective was to compare the frequence of identification of urinary bladder lesions in dogs using ultrasonography and positive contrast cystography and, also, determine the efficacy of these imaging procedures in indicating diagnostic hipothesis. This prospective study consisted of 35 dogs, males and females, from different breeds and ages, referred to Imaging Diagnostic Service of Veterinary Teaching Hospital (Faculdade de Medicina Veterinária e Zootecnia da Universidade de São Paulo) with clinical signs suggestive of bladder diseases. The positive contrast cystography was more efficient in detecting mucosal surface irregularity, bladder displacement and intraluminal structures except calculi. The ultrasonography identified more often uroliths and bladder wall thickening. Diverticula and bladder rupture were demonstrated only by contrast radiography and urinary sludge by sonographic exam. Intraluminal gas presence, related to emphysematous cystitis, was observed by both techniques. In 23 of 35 cases (65,7%) both of techniques were necessary to provide a complete diagnostic and in 12 cases (34,3%) the perform of just one kind of exam could indicated the diagnostic hipothesis.

Arterial vascularization of the uterine horns in pregnant cross breed cats (Felis catus Linnaeus, 1758)

The arterial vascularization of the uterine horns in 24 pregnant cross breed cats were studied. In 20 animals, with gestation between 7 and 9 weeks, the abdominal aorta was injected with Neoprene latex 650 solution associated with bario sulphate 1004. The X-ray were taked and the animals were fixed in formaldehyde 10% aqueous solution and dissected to study the arterial distribution to paraplacentary and placentary zone. The Power Doppler Ecocardiografh was realized in 4 animals, in paraplacentary zones the vessels resistence rate is smaller than trought uterine artery. In all observations, the uterine artery is the principal vessel to vascularize the uterine horns, emitting 2 to 17 branches, with hight frequence 5 to 12 branches, that wich running to paraplacentary zone and/or placentary zone, forming the anastomotic arcade. There is not estatistical significative difference between branches number from each region individually, however the X-ray analyses showed a hight constrast concentration in regions of the placentary zone. The ovaric artery has participation in arterial vascularization to cranial extremity of the uterine horns, where it makes anastomosis with branches from uterine artery.

Comparative study between manual and mechanical suture of bronchial stamp in dogs submited to left pneumonectomy: histopahological evaluation of right lung and electrocardiographical evaluation

The study had purpose to evaluate the possible electrocardiographical alterations and the histopathological alterations in the lung of dogs submited by left pneumonectomy with comparative approach between two types of suture of bronchial stamp (manual and mechanical). We used twelve dogs, males and females, adults, mongrel dogs, weighting between 15 and 20 kilograms and evaluated the macroscopic alterations of right lung and the alterations of electrocardiogram. All animals showed clinical condition satisfactory in the post operated time. The electrocardiographical alterations were deviation of cardiac axis, sinoatrial block and miocardial isquemia. The histopathological alterations were pulmonary atelectasis, proliferations of bronchiole epithelium tended to obliterations and pulmonary emphysema. The study suggested that right lung was submited to pulmonary hipertension.

Placental fissure in mongrel cats, Felis catus - Linnaeus, 1758: gross and microscopical aspects

This research consists of study of shematic macroscopy cat's placenta and placental characterization as its type, zonary placenta, that 62,5% of cases presents a fissure at distal area of umbilical cord. This is formed by a joustfetal area, joustplacental area and middle area, histological findings: two arteries, a vein, two vitelline pedicule and two allantois pedicule. In the fissure, an allantoic epithelium covering this area at 10% of the cases and 90% found a trophoblast decrease compared with others placental areas out of the fissure. So, the feline placenta, in its maternal/fetal relationship shows a imcomplete zonary placenta, different of that occurs in other carnivores.

Preweaning piglets mortality in a intensive swine production system

Two research was conducted to evaluate and to classify the occurrence of the preweaning losses (based on the postmortem findings) of piglets in an intense swine production system, at the west of São Paulo State during the year 2000. Among total piglets born alive. 7.19 % died during the first 24 suckling days, but most of them (5.63 %) died on the 1st week of life all over the year. The most important causes of losses were overlaying (2.61 %), weakness (1.45 %), diarrhea syndrome (1.10 %), and genetic defects (0.56 %), occurring mainly on the 1st week of life. Stillbirth rate, in relation to total born, was 5.96 %. Evidences indicated higher number of overlaying during the hottest months of the year, caused probably by the longer staying out of the piglet's pen. It was suggested some control measures to reduce the piglets mortality in order to maximize the productive efficiency of the system.

Structural features of the epididymal region of the domestic duck (Anas plathyrynchos)

The epididymal region of the domestic duck is composed by efferent ductules, whose histotopology was characterized by the proximal and distal ductules and sequentially by the epididymal duct. The epithelial lining of the efferent ductules was ciliated pseudostratified and formed by columnar cells. Also the ducts epididymidis epithelium was pseudostratified but non-ciliated. Concerning the histomorphometric analysis, the epithelial height mean was significantly greater in the distal efferent ductules, differing from the lower epithelium height mean observed in proximal efferent ductules and epididymal duct. The maximum and minimum diameter mean were significantly greater in the proximal efferent ductules, comparatively to the same diameter means of the other ductules.

Evaluation testicular fine needle aspiration cytology and serum testosterone levels in dogs

In order to verify alternative clinical approach in the reproductive evaluation of 4 adult dogs, the fine needle aspiration cytology (FNAC) and serum testosterone levels were used together with testicular volume measurement and semen analysis. FNAC was performed in both testes and serum testosterone concentrations were assayed in regular intervals during a 24h period. Results of semen analysis and FNAC were normal in dogs 1 and 3. In dog 2, small testes, poor semen quality, a high percentage of Sertoli cells and early spermatids were found suggesting testicular degeneration. In dog 4, a small right testicle, poor semen quality with low sperm concentration and an uncounted amount of spermatozoa in the FNAC indicated testicular degeneration due to an obstructive lesion; whereas high percentage of distal droplets, thicker left epididymis and normal FNAC of the left testis suggested a slow sperm transit. Testosterone circadian rhythm was clear in 3 of 4 dogs, although concentrations were low. Testicular volume, semen analysis and testicular FNAC could provide valuable information about spermatogenesis. In contrast, serum testosterone concentration was not clearly correlated with any reproductive characteristic of those dogs.
